The Science Behind Our Odor Removal Process
Odor removal is a complex process that needs a thorough understanding of the underlying causes. Our team identifies the source of the smell, whether it’s a bacterial growth, chemical contamination, or something else. We then develop a customized plan to remove the odor and prevent future occurrences.
Step 1: Assessment
Within 60 minutes of arrival, our technician will assess the damage, identify the source of the odor, and develop a plan to remove it. Strong smell detection and identification are crucial to effective odor removal.
Step 2: Decontamination
Once the source of the odor is identified, our technician will use specialized equipment to decontaminate the affected area. This process involves the use of odor-neutralizing agents and anti-microbial treatments to remove the smell and prevent further contamination.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
After decontamination, our technician will ensure the area is thoroughly dried and dehumidified to prevent moisture-related issues. This step is critical in preventing bacterial growth and fungal development.
Step 4: Odor Elimination
Using specialized equipment and techniques, our technician will remove any remaining odor molecules. This process can take up to 2 hours depending on the severity of the damage.
Step 5: Final Inspection and Cleanup
Once the odor has been eliminated, our technician will conduct a final inspection to ensure the area is safe and free from any remaining contamination. The area will be thoroughly cleaned and disinfected to prevent future issues.

Odor Removal After Water Damage Cost in Ennis, TX
The cost of odor removal after water damage varies based on the severity of the issue,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Ennis, TX. These estimates are based on real-world costs homeowners face.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Assessment and Planning | $100 – $500 | Severity of damage and size of affected area |
| Decontamination and Drying |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area and type of contamination |
| Odor Elimination | $200 – $1,000 | Severity of odor and type of equipment needed |
Exact pricing depends on an on-site assessment. We offer free estimates to give you a more accurate quote.
